Which Billing Software is Best for Small Businesses? 2026 Selection Guide
When small business owners ask, "Which billing software is best for my business?", they are rarely looking for a feature list. They want to know: Will this software make checkout faster at my counter? Will it keep my taxes compliant without hours of manual entry? And will it work on the hardware I already own?
The Indian billing software market is vast. Options range from traditional on-premise accounting powerhouses like Tally and Busy, to mobile-first apps like Vyapar and myBillBook, to modern cloud POS platforms like BillEase, and enterprise ERP ecosystems like Zoho.
There is no universal "winner." The best billing software depends entirely on your operational archetype: your transaction volume, whether you sell physical products across a counter or invoice service clients at month-end, whether you manage multiple branches, and your comfort with technology.

Thermal paper rolls are expensive (adding ₹0.50 to ₹1.50 per invoice), prone to fading within months, and environmentally wasteful. A modern billing system should allow sending branded digital receipts directly to customers' WhatsApp numbers with a single click. This reduces printing costs while providing customers with a permanent, searchable record.5. Offline Resilience
Indian retail environments frequently face spotty internet connections or power flickers. If your internet connection drops for twenty minutes during an evening rush, does your billing register freeze? Look for systems with offline billing resilience, where transactions continue processing in local device storage and automatically synchronize with cloud databases once the connection restores.6. The 4-Step Action Plan to Choose Your Tool
1. Audit Your Current Hardware: List the devices you currently have at your store (tablets, old laptops, smartphones). If you want to avoid spending ₹30,000+ on new computers, eliminate software that requires dedicated Windows installations.
2. Determine Your Peak Transaction Speed: During your busiest hour, how many customers do you serve? If it is more than 30 customers an hour, test the checkout flow of candidate tools using a demo account.
3. Ask Your Accountant About Formats: Confirm what format your CA prefers for monthly returns. Most CAs only require standard Excel/CSV exports of sales registers with split CGST/SGST/IGST columns.
4. Run a 7-Day Live Test: Never commit to an annual software subscription without testing it at your actual counter. Take advantage of free trials to verify printer compatibility, barcode scanning, and staff ease-of-use.
Frequently Asked Questions
Is cloud billing software safe for confidential financial data?
Reputable cloud platforms use enterprise-grade encrypted connections (HTTPS/TLS) and secure database hosting. Unlike local desktop computers, which are vulnerable to local hard drive crashes, ransomware, or physical theft, cloud platforms back up data automatically.Can I use my existing thermal printer with cloud billing software?
Yes. Standard thermal receipt printers (58mm and 80mm) connect via USB, Bluetooth, or network Wi-Fi. In browser-based systems, printing uses the standard system print dialog configured for your printer's paper width.What is the difference between simple billing software and full ERP?
Simple billing software focuses on customer-facing checkout, tax calculation, and receipt generation.
